Hair Commanders
7118 Natural Bridge Rd, Saint Louis, MO 63121
More Business Info
- Hours
- Do you know the hours for this business?
- Extra Phones
Phone: 314-448-1531
- Neighborhoods
- North Oaks Plaza, Northwoods
- AKA
Hair Commanders Inc
- Categories
- Beauty Salons, Hair Stylists
Suggest an Edit